Kwara State Unveils Major Irrigation and Water Investment Plans
As disclosed by Blueprint, In response to the recent halt in rainfall attributed to climate change, the Kwara State Government has unveiled plans for an extensive irrigation project, which will cover large expanses of land in the Omu-Aran and Dukulade communities.
Additionally, the government has revealed a comprehensive 30-year water and investment plan for the state. The proposed initiatives will be implemented in collaboration with the African Development Bank (AFDB) and the Kwara State Government.
This announcement was made by the Kwara State Commissioner for Water Resources, Usman Lade, during the quarterly ministerial press briefing. The briefing was chaired by the Commissioner for Communications, Mrs Bola Olukoju, and also featured the attendance of the Chief Press Secretary to the Governor, Mallam Rafiu Ajakaye.
The commissioner said the choice of Omu- Aran in Kwara South senatorial district and Dukulade in Kwara North, was arrived at because they meet the standard requirement of having at least 500 hectares of land available for irrigation farming.
Lade said the project is to ensure that farmers in the state practice all year round agriculture leveraging on the opportunities available with the dams in the areas.
Blueprint recalls that the federal government had through the Lower Niger River Basin Development Authority, Ilorin in 2023, commissioned a 3.5 million cubic water capacity dam that will power at least 150, 000 hectares of irrigation farm land in Omu- Aran, Irepodun local government.
On the efforts to end open defecation, Lade disclosed that the state government under it RUWASA project have constructed 10 smart toilets each in three selected local governments assuring that more will be replicated in other local government areas.
